html如何设置为粗体

html如何设置为粗体

HTML如何设置为粗体,可以使用以下几种方法:使用<b>标签、使用<strong>标签、使用CSS的font-weight属性。其中,最常用的是<b>标签和<strong>标签。使用<b>标签可以直接使文本变为粗体,而使用<strong>标签不仅使文本变为粗体,还赋予其语义上的重要性。让我们详细探讨一下如何在HTML中设置文本为粗体。

一、使用<b>标签

1. 基本用法

<b>标签是HTML中最简单也是最早用于设置文本为粗体的标签。它不会改变文本的语义,只是简单地将文本显示为粗体。

<p>这是一个普通文本,<b>这是一个粗体文本</b>。</p>

在上述代码中,<b>标签包裹的文本“这是一个粗体文本”会以粗体显示。

2. 注意事项

虽然<b>标签可以轻松实现文本的粗体效果,但由于它不具备语义上的意义,现代网页开发中更多推荐使用<strong>标签。<b>标签更多地用于需要纯样式效果的场合。

二、使用<strong>标签

1. 基本用法

<strong>标签不仅能使文本变为粗体,还能赋予其语义上的重要性。例如,当你想强调文本的重要性时,可以使用<strong>标签。

<p>这是一个普通文本,<strong>这是一个重要的粗体文本</strong>。</p>

在上述代码中,<strong>标签包裹的文本“这是一个重要的粗体文本”不仅会以粗体显示,还传达了文本的重要性。

2. SEO优势

使用<strong>标签不仅有助于视觉效果,还能让搜索引擎更好地理解文本内容的层次和重点,提高网页的SEO效果。

三、使用CSS的font-weight属性

1. 基本用法

CSS提供了更灵活的方式来设置文本的字体粗细。通过使用font-weight属性,你可以不仅将文本设置为粗体,还能设置不同的粗细程度。

<p>这是一个普通文本,<span style="font-weight: bold;">这是一个粗体文本</span>。</p>

在上述代码中,style属性中的font-weight: bold;让span标签包裹的文本变为粗体。

2. 多种粗细程度

font-weight属性不仅可以设置为bold,还可以设置具体数值(100到900),以实现不同的粗细程度。例如:

<p>这是一个普通文本,<span style="font-weight: 700;">这是一个700粗细的文本</span>。</p>

这种方式提供了更丰富的视觉效果和更高的灵活性。

四、结合使用

在实际开发中,常常需要结合使用多种方法。例如,你可以使用<strong>标签来赋予文本语义上的重要性,同时用CSS来进一步控制其粗细程度。

<p>这是一个普通文本,<strong style="font-weight: 700;">这是一个重要且700粗细的文本</strong>。</p>

五、在现代网页设计中的应用

1. 响应式设计

在响应式设计中,设置文本为粗体不仅仅是为了视觉效果,还需要考虑到不同设备的显示效果。使用CSS可以更好地控制不同设备上的字体粗细。

@media (max-width: 600px) {

.important-text {

font-weight: bold;

}

}

@media (min-width: 601px) {

.important-text {

font-weight: 700;

}

}

2. 可访问性

使用语义化标签(如<strong>)可以提高网页的可访问性,让屏幕阅读器等辅助工具更好地理解网页内容。

六、实际应用案例

1. 新闻网站

在新闻网站中,经常需要突出重要内容。使用<strong>标签可以让读者和搜索引擎更好地理解文章的重点。

<article>

<h1>新闻标题</h1>

<p>这是新闻的正文内容。<strong>这是新闻中最重要的一句话。</strong></p>

</article>

2. 电商网站

在电商网站中,产品的重要信息(如价格、折扣)通常需要突出显示。结合使用CSS和HTML标签,可以实现更好的视觉效果。

<div class="product">

<h2>产品名称</h2>

<p>价格:<span style="font-weight: bold;">$199.99</span></p>

<p>折扣:<strong style="font-weight: 700;">50% OFF</strong></p>

</div>

七、总结

在HTML中设置文本为粗体可以通过多种方法实现,如使用<b>标签、<strong>标签和CSS的font-weight属性。每种方法都有其适用场景和优缺点。在实际开发中,推荐结合使用语义化标签和CSS,以实现更好的视觉效果和SEO性能

通过对这些方法的灵活应用,你可以在不同的场合下实现最佳的文本显示效果,同时提高网页的可访问性和搜索引擎优化效果。

相关问答FAQs:

1. 如何在HTML中将文本设置为粗体?

要将文本设置为粗体,您可以使用HTML的<b><strong>标签。这些标签可以用来强调文本,使其显示为粗体。您可以在需要设置为粗体的文本周围使用这些标签,如下所示:

<p>这是一段普通的文本,<b>这是粗体文本</b>,这是普通文本。</p>

2. HTML中的<b><strong>有什么区别?

<b>标签是用于将文本设置为粗体,它仅仅改变了文本的外观,没有语义上的强调。而<strong>标签不仅将文本设置为粗体,还向读者传达了强调的意义。根据HTML规范,<strong>标签应该用于强调重要的文本内容。

3. 是否可以使用CSS样式来设置文本为粗体?

是的,除了使用HTML标签,您还可以使用CSS样式来设置文本为粗体。通过在CSS样式表中定义相应的样式规则,您可以选择要设置为粗体的文本元素,并将其字体设置为粗体。以下是一个示例:

<style>
    .bold-text {
        font-weight: bold;
    }
</style>

<p>这是一段普通的文本,<span class="bold-text">这是使用CSS样式设置的粗体文本</span>,这是普通文本。</p>

请注意,在上面的示例中,我们使用了一个带有.bold-text类的<span>标签来应用CSS样式,并将文本设置为粗体。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/2997247

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部